PURPOSE: To measure a location of a sedimentation surface of a liquid to be inspected rapidly by a method wherein a transmitter and a receiver for ultrasonic signals are mounted to the bottom of a cylinder body of the sedimentation pipe, and a circuit is fitted which measures the time difference of the transmission and reception of the ultrasonic signals reflecting on the sedimentation surface of the liquid to be inspected and operates.
CONSTITUTION: When a deposit 70 and a supernatant liquid 71 separate in a sedimentation pipe 7, transmission pulses are emitted from a transmission circuit 50, and a transmitter-receiver 11 forwards transmission signals 73 into the deposit 70 while inputting the transmission pulses to a time counter 61. The transmission signals 73 are reflected on a sedimentation surface 72, and reflecting signals 74 are received by means of the transmitter-receiver 11, and inputted to the time counter 61 through a reception circuit 51. The time counter 61 measures the time difference of two signals, and inputs the value to a calculator 62. Temperature signals from a water temperature detector 63 are input to the computing element 62, and a location of the sedimentation surface 72 is calculated on the basis of both signals.
